Choosing the Right Oil: 4T vs. Other Lubricants
When it comes to keeping your engine running smoothly, selecting the appropriate oil is crucial. There are many different types of oil available, and understanding their differences can assist you make the right choice for your vehicle.
One popular type of oil is 4T oil, also known as four-stroke oil. This type of oil is designed specifically for ,engines with four strokes, which are present in most modern motorcycles and automobiles. It's formulated to provide optimal lubrication and protection under a wide range of operating situations.
Yet, there are other types of oil available, such as two-stroke oil and synthetic oil. Two-stroke oil is designed for engines with a different operating cycle and shouldn't be used in four-stroke engines. Synthetic oil is made from refined materials and often offers improved performance compared to conventional oil.
To determine the best type of oil for your vehicle, it's always recommended to consult your owner's manual or a qualified mechanic. They can provide precise recommendations based on your engine's needs and operating conditions.
Lubrication Best Practices: From Oils to Greases
When it comes to achieving smooth and efficient operation in machinery and equipment, proper lubrication plays a crucial role. Choosing the right lubricant, whether that is an oil or a grease, can significantly impact performance, longevity, and overall maintenance. Oils are typically utilized in applications requiring consistent movement between moving parts, while greases provide extended protection against wear and tear in harsh environments.
- In order to effectively implement lubrication best practices, consider the following factors:
- The type of machinery or equipment being lubricated
- Environmental conditions, like temperature and load
- Grease viscosity and compatibility with the materials in contact
Always consult the producer's recommendations for lubrication guidelines and adhere to a regular service schedule for ensure optimal performance and prevent premature wear.
